Abstract

A power module according to an embodiment of the present invention comprises: a first substrate having metal plates formed on one surface thereof; a second substrate spaced apart from the first substrate and having metal plates formed on one surface thereof facing the metal plates of the first substrate; a plurality of power elements disposed between the first substrate and the second substrate; afirst electrode formed on the first surface of each of the plurality of power elements; and a second electrode formed on the second surface of each of the plurality of power elements, wherein the plurality of power elements comprise a first power element in which the first electrode is bonded to the metal plates of the second substrate; and a second power element in which the first electrode is bonded to the metal plates of the first substrate.

technical field [0001] The invention relates to a double-sided cooling type power module and a manufacturing method thereof, which are installed in environment-friendly vehicles such as electric vehicles, hybrid vehicles, and fuel cell vehicles, and household appliances such as air conditioners. Background technique [0002] Generally, a motor can be provided as a driving unit in an electric vehicle, a hybrid vehicle, a fuel cell vehicle and other environment-friendly vehicles, or an air conditioner and other household appliances. Such a motor may be driven by a three-phase current delivered through a power cable from an inverter that converts a DC voltage into a three-phase voltage through a PWM (pulse width modulation) signal of a controller. [0003] The inverter may be provided with a power element that performs an operation of supplying power for driving the motor using power supplied from a power supply unit.
